It emphasizes the idea that arguments are not just limited to formal debates or essays but permeate everyday life, media, and various disciplines. Through a combination of theory, examples, and practical exercises, the book encourages readers to recognize and analyze arguments in a myriad of formats, enhancing their critical thinking and persuasive skills.
The bibliographic details for the 8th Edition are as follows: ISBN 978-1319056326, published by Bedford/St. Martin's. The authors of this edition, Andrea A. Lunsford, John J. Ruszkiewicz, and Keith Walters, draw upon their extensive backgrounds in writing and communication to provide insightful guidance on the intricacies of argumentation. Their collaborative efforts result in a rich and engaging text that aligns with contemporary communication practices.
In this edition, the authors introduce updated examples and contemporary references that resonate with today’s readers, offering methods to dissect arguments found in social media, advertisements, and political discourse. The book includes various approaches to argumentation, such as emotional appeal, logical reasoning, and ethical persuasion, equipping students with the tools necessary to craft their arguments across different platforms and audiences.
